Output e573f2dd33f8e1b627aae189fd7bfdbf3eb6a46193f0225c2d5cb6233065748b:1

value
43076832
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 393acf548d5e5c7e61d92999902816a10bc19a60 OP_EQUALVERIFY OP_CHECKSIG
address
16Dby7mbL5pbzsAUq6sTkQ9GnBXJqFY9x4
transaction
e573f2dd33f8e1b627aae189fd7bfdbf3eb6a46193f0225c2d5cb6233065748b
confirmations
344897
spent
true